We put a 1970 360 hp 455 in our '72 Lemans. It has a 230 degree .480" lift cam and headers. The 235 70 Goodyears radials are no traction at all. It will light the tires just getting onto it in low gear at 25-30 mph. 60-90 mph it will pull our L78 Chevelle by 2 1/2 car lengths so it isn't all bottom end power. These engines were rated at 500 ft lb of torque from the factory. Most people don't realize the performance to be had from a Pontiac.
